You need to construct a modeline for your adapter/monitor
combination.

On the LTSP.org related links page, there is a link to
the modelines howto, explaining how to calculate a modeline
entry.

Also, check out the lts.conf.readme file located in
/opt/ltsp/i386/etc.  It contains a full list of all of
the allowable parameters for the lts.conf file.
